The cost of living difference between Cairo, IL and St. Francisville, IL is dramatic. Cairo is 38.8% cheaper than St. Francisville, a gap that translates to thousands of dollars per year in household expenses. Cairo has a cost index of 41 while St. Francisville sits at 67, making this one of the more striking comparisons on our site. Relocating between these cities would require a serious reassessment of budget and lifestyle expectations.

On the housing front, median rent in Cairo is $282/month compared to $943/month in St. Francisville — a 70% difference. Home values follow the same pattern: Cairo is more affordable at $28,200 median vs $58,400.

Median household income in Cairo is $35,493 compared to $64,583 in St. Francisville (-45%). While St. Francisville is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income. Looking at affordability, residents of Cairo spend roughly 9.5% of their income on rent, less than the 17.5% in St. Francisville.
